  • Bread, Wine, and Money : The Windows of the Trades at Chartres Cathedral
  • Written by author Jane W. Williams
  • Published by University of Chicago Press, 1993/03/01
  • At Chartres Cathedral, for the first time in medieval art, the lowest register of stained-glass windows depicts working artisans and merchants instead of noble and clerical donors. Jane Welch Williams challenges the prevailing view that pious town tradesm
